parts,labor,paint-$4500
ccw 19/20 505a's wheel & tire pkg(mounted, balanced & shipped)-$4800
(could have gone stock wheels and tires for $2300)
when i got this car complete i thought it was worth all the money. new a6 z51 for $44k-brings my total to about $51k. if i could have got the 06 zo6 for an msrp for $66k, i would have been more than happy to have spent the xtra $15k.(cant forget pay more tax & higher reg fees-almost $18k) in my honest opinion, i think $15k more for a actual z, better suspension, 100hp more, better brakes, better resale value, would have been a great deal. but buying a new zo6 in march of 06 @ msrp was not available. i had about $50k to play with and wanted one now! wish i would have waited a year and got a used one for $60k.

Default Lowering kit

Originally Posted by TESTOSTERONE C5-R







I ONLY CHANGE MY REAR BOLTS.
Rear lowering bolts all the way down and front factory bolts; all the way down. no need to replace the front bolts.
JUST MAKE SURE WHEN YOU GET THE LOWERING BOLTS THEY NEED TO BE LUBRICATED IF NOT YOU WILL HAVE A GRIDING/clicking SOUND that can be confuse with the noise from the differential. Trust me, they change my differential fluid thinking it was the differential. And after some though i figure to spray some wd-40 on the rear bolts and wallaaaaaa noise gone. just put some grease on the bolts....
My experience....
I got my Z06 spoiler and now is coming alive....ALIVE...ALIVE!!!! YES!!

This never stops....have fun till the end!
Zip Corvettes sells a lowering kit using your existing bolts -kit has four rubber cups that go over the bolts (they look like little hockey pucks) after you cut the original rubber bushing off-protects your A Arms-I had them done on mine dropped it 2 Inches.

Amazing how all of the people who said no only commented on looks and cost with no mention of what traction is worth. Add just the rear fenders and 18x12 inch wheels (could be repro 18x9.5's widened to 12")with 345 drag radials and you have one of the best single mods for speed that you can get for a car with engine mods......oh yeah the same guys run near stock power because mods cost too much and violate the warranty....

Even the Z06 wheels to run 345 pilot sports with stock size repros in the front/stock tires will far outperform.
